I'm using Ripbot264 since a week on 3 PC, i had some crash but it's totally worth it After converting my videos to 60fps with MeGUI, i encode them to x265 with PLACEBO preset crf 21 I'ill try to describe some problems i've encoutered. my config: 3 pc windows 8.1 PC 1 (main): i7 12 threads PC 2 (old pc): i7 8 threads PC 3 (my brother's pc): i5 4 threads Problem 1 (solved): the first was my bad, after waiting some hours the end of my first encode, epic fail ! i was using an outaded server version on my pc 2 Solution 1 : the client could check servers versions. Problem 2 (semi-solved): my pcs were encoding 24/24 and every single day x265_x64.exe( i tried with several builds) crashed randomly when a chunk is at 100% eta 00.00.00 i got about 2 or 3 crash for 30 chunks everydays on pc 2 and 3, but it never happened on my main pc, so i think you can identify the problem. When x265_x64.exe crash, the chunk is stuck at 100% and Ripbot264 client continue the other current chunks, then after some time all chunks are stucked so every morning Ripbot264 was stucked when i wake up then i had to restart it. Solution 1: close the windows error dialog, if i close it fast, x265_x64.exe will just restart for the next chunk and all work well, but i can't click the night when i'm sleeping Solution 2: modify with regedit the value of H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\ Microsoft\Windows\Windows Error Reporting\DontShowUI and set to 1. the video will be encoded without pause but this solution is not clean. Solution 3: You can try to find the origin of this problem and correct it but i'm unable to reproduce it it's totally random. Hi,
I have an mpeg2 video (DVD), mediainfo shows: Code:
Frame rate mode : Constant Frame rate : 25.000 fps Scan type : Interlaced Scan order : Top Field First In the ripbot properties the "deinterlacing" (and "decimate") options are greyed out (all other options are available), so it isnt possible to select anything. What to do? Thanks. |
10th March 2015, 18:11 | #13395 | Link |
RipBot264 author
Join Date: May 2006
Location: Poland
Posts: 7,806
|
Add this to script
Code:
video=AssumeFPS(video,25) #Deinterlace LoadCplugin("[CORRECT_PATH_TO_RIPBOT264]\Tools\AviSynth plugins\Yadif\Yadif.dll") video=yadif(video,mode=1,order=1)
